    Ok... more changes... or reversal of a prior change... the last two PMs I had done was told to do OTR... ok... done... the last truck I was in had no sticker so no idea when the last PM was performed on it... called the garage and they had no clue when it was last done.

    Today, I get a pro active text from DM saying that my Truck is due for a PM (still 3k away but getting close)... said to take it to either Richmond or West Memphis when I come back out.

    So ya, someone is now tracking the status of the company equipment (not a bad thing), we get pro active heads up, and I guess we are no longer to get them done OTR.

    while I do track when my PM is due, it’s nice to know that the company is tracking important events to help maintain the fleet.

    now, will they start tracking trailer inspections?
